The AR multipurpose bitmap (the thing that tells the game what is shiny) was taken out of the PC version. That is either from an XBOX, or before the bitmap was taken out. In CE you can put the bitmap back in, but thats CE. The AR's shinyness doesn't have anything to do with the card.
